Hello,
My wife stayed in the UK as a PBS dependent (TIER 2) visa for 4 years and 10months and had to apply for a the Spouse of settled person visa as her TIER 2 Dependent visa was expiring 2 months before the 5 year period eligibility for ILR was completed.

After 1 year in the Spouse of settled person visa we applied for indefinite leave in the UK as the partner of a settled person (SET(M)) abd was rejected.

Could some one explain if the ILR eligibility clock is reset if she switch the visa category? IS this clear from immigration rules? I cannot see where this has been specified clearly.

Many thanks in advance for any support.

Why did you switch to FLR M visa instead of extending pbs dependent visa??

On what basis did you get ILR, 5 years tier 2 or 10 years long residence??

To qualify for ILR on form Set M, she must have 5 years residence on spouse Settlment visa. Time spent as pbs dependent doesn't count and cannot be used to make up 5 years.

Yes. The immigration rules are clear in this requirement.

The rule allowing combining the two categories changed in April 2014.

Immigration Rules Appendix FM states the 60 month requirement clearly.

https://www.gov.uk/guidance/immigration ... ly-members
Section E-ILRP: Eligibility for indefinite leave to remain as a partner

E-ILRP.1.1. To meet the eligibility requirements for indefinite leave to remain as a partner all of the requirements of paragraphs E-ILRP.1.2. to 1.6. must be met.

E-ILRP.1.2. The applicant must be in the UK with valid leave to remain as a partner under this Appendix (except that, where paragraph 39E of these Rules applies, any current period of overstaying will be disregarded).

E-ILRP.1.3. (1) Subject to sub-paragraph (2), the applicant must, at the date of application, have completed a continuous period of either:

(a) at least 60 months in the UK with:
(i) leave to enter granted on the basis of entry clearance as a partner granted under paragraph D-ECP.1.1.; or
(ii) limited leave to remain as a partner granted under paragraph D-LTRP.1.1.; or
(iii) a combination of (i) and (ii);
